python怎么连接数据库_python3.x怎么连接mysql数据库
第三步連接mysql數(shù)據(jù)庫之后,就可以通過sql語句來讀取數(shù)據(jù)庫內(nèi)容了,完整代碼如下:
import pymysql.cursor
# 連接MySQL數(shù)據(jù)庫
connection = pymysql.connect(host='localhost', port=3306, user='root', passwd='123456'db='coal_blending',charset='utf8mb4', cursorclass=pymysql.cursors.DictCursor)
try:
# 通過cursor創(chuàng)建游標(biāo)
cursor = connection.cursor()
# 創(chuàng)建sql 語句
sql = "select * from coal_blead"
# 執(zhí)行sql語句
cursor.execute(sql)
# 獲取所有記錄列表
results = cursor.fetchall() print(results) for data in results: # 打印結(jié)果 print(data)
except Exception :print("查詢失敗")
#關(guān)閉游標(biāo)連接cursor.close()# 關(guān)閉數(shù)據(jù)庫連接connection.close()
總結(jié)
以上是生活随笔為你收集整理的python怎么连接数据库_python3.x怎么连接mysql数据库的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: FTC要求微软提交更多保供细节
- 下一篇: ue4 怎么修改骨骼动画_【UE4】动画